i love v3 of this simple and accurate map that has distinctive national flavour and gameplay. do the continents (regions) have any cultural, ethnic, administrative or traditional meaning, or are they just geographical?

the new bonuses are all good. i’d also reduce the noroeste bonus to +3 (less than occidente) because noroeste has an attractive, quiet location in the corner and is not on anyone’s attack route (while occidente, in the middle, is very easy for anyone to attack).

in anillo central, what is EM? estado de mexico? when i search for that, the website below appears. is edomex a suitable name for estado de mexico on our map, instead of EM, or does only the government use this name?

http://www.edomex.gob.mx/portal/page/portal/edomex

the english name for golfo de mexico is gulf of mexico, not mexican gulf. if u use golfo de mexico, then i think everyone will understand the meaning, although maybe gulf of mexico is better if u are using the english name to explain the port bonuses. what do u think?

i think the original bonus of 6 is suitable for anillo central; the new one of only 5 is too small. anillo central is very similar to iberia's castilla la mancha continent which, just like anillo central, has 7 territories, of which 5 are border territories; also like anillo central, it is located in the middle, so that nearly every continent can attack it directly. castilla la mancha has a bonus of 7.

http://www.conquerclub.com/maps/Iberia.S.jpg

in the anillo central box, the name for veracruz is diagonal. all other names on the map are straight left to right. it'll look better if veracruz also reads straight across from left to right.

i'm liking this map a lot. would some texture improve the look of the land, or would texture make the map less clear?
